Cheese Pandan Pandesal
DifficultyMedium
Servings24 Servings
Prep time3 hours
Cook time20 minutes
Total time3 hours20 minutes
Cheese Pandan Pandesal is soft, fluffy bread rolls infused with pandan flavor and filled with creamy cheese. Perfect for breakfast or snacks!
Ingredients
Dry Ingredients:
- 4 cups All-purpose Flour
- 1 tbsp Instant Yeast
- 1/2 cup Sugar
- 1/2 tsp Salt
Wet Ingredients:
- 1 cup Milk, Warm
- 1/4 cup Water, Warm
- 1/4 cup Unsalted Butter, Melted
- 1 tsp Pandan Extract
Filling:
- 1 cup Edan Cheese or Cheddar Cheese, Grated
Coating:
- 1/2 cup Bread Crumbs
Instructions
- 1
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the flour, instant yeast, sugar, and salt.
- 2
Prepare Wet Ingredients: In a separate bowl, mix the warm milk, warm water, melted butter, egg, and pandan extract.
- 3
Combine Ingredients: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ients. Mix until well combined.
- 4
Knead the Dough: Knead the dough using an electric mixer with a dough hook attachment for about 10 minutes, or until the dough is smooth and elastic.
- 5
First Rise: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over it with a clean towel, and let it rise in a warm place for about 2 hours, or until it has doubled in size.
- 6
Shape the Dough: Punch down the dough to release the air. Divide the dough into equal portions and shape each portion into a ball.
- 7
Add Filling: Flatten each dough ball slightly and place a small amount of grated cheese in the center. Pinch the edges to seal and shape it back into a ball.
- 8
Coat with Bread Crumbs: Roll each filled dough ball in bread crumbs and place them on a baking tray lined with parchment paper.
- 9
Second Rise: Cover the tray with a clean towel and let the dough balls rise for another hour.
- 10
Bake: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Bake the pandesal for about 20 minutes, or until they are lightly golden brown.
- 11
Serve: Enjoy your Cheese Pandan Pandesal while they are warm!

Notes
Adjust the amount of pandan extract and cheese to suit your taste.
Ensure the milk and water are warm, not hot, to activate the yeast properly.
